  • I decided I needed to try out a wide angle lens to see how I get on with it for woodland and perhaps star field photography.
    Come join me at Sherwood Forest for a wander for the first time with my new Olympus M.Zuiko 9-18mm f/4-5.6 lens and see how I get on with it.
